Transaction 2a593384bbad01309117fcc1145d4ebe0f80c6e59691cabcc70d22eadc28e7fe

1 Input
2 Outputs
  • 2a593384bbad01309117fcc1145d4ebe0f80c6e59691cabcc70d22eadc28e7fe:0
  • value  599704409
    address  3JSfHrrM33x8FMzykSGKLDop3ubNrHee8Q
  • 2a593384bbad01309117fcc1145d4ebe0f80c6e59691cabcc70d22eadc28e7fe:1
  • value  672090000
    address  1HpQJikpAKFinDG6y4yNWfTjo1FP43HmwG